Software Ingenieur (m/w/d)
Heinzinger electronic GmbH | Rosenheim
Wir bieten professionelle Unterstützung bei der Konzipierung und Entwicklung von Bedienoberflächen und Software. Unser erfahrenes Team erstellt und führt Unit-, Integrations- und Systemtests durch und sorgt für eine umfassende Dokumentation. Wir unterstützen Sie bei der Inbetriebnahme und Systemintegration in Ihrem Unternehmen und bei Ihren Kunden. Dabei arbeiten wir eng mit Hardware-Ingenieuren, Projekt- und Produktmanagern zusammen. Unser Team verfügt über ein abgeschlossenes Hochschulstudium im Bereich Embedded Systems Engineering, Elektrotechnik, Informatik oder einer vergleichbaren Fachrichtung. Wir beherrschen die Programmiersprachen C/C++ und verfügen über umfangreiche Erfahrung in der Programmierung von Mikrocontrollern. Zusätzlich haben wir Kenntnisse in der Programmierung von DSPs unter Einbeziehung von FPGAs. Darüber hinaus sind wir mit den Programmiersprachen C#, Python und Java Script vertraut. Wir bringen auch Erfahrung im Versions Management (Git) und Grundkenntnisse in der Nutzung von Schnittstellen (SPI/I2C/CAN/USB/Ethernet) und den entsprechenden Kommunikationsprotokollen mit.